immunodecorated

From Wiktionary, the free dictionary

Remove ads

English

Etymology

From immuno- + decorated.

Adjective

immunodecorated (not comparable)

  1. Having immunodecoration
    • 2015 August 12, “Chronic Insulin Exposure Induces ER Stress and Lipid Body Accumulation in Mast Cells at the Expense of Their Secretory Degranulation Response”, in PLOS ONE, →DOI:
      Counting was performed in a sample-blinded fashion and expressed as % of 200 counted cells ( D ) and mean of the number of immunodecorated structures per cell ( E ).
